Re: Ronnie Peterson and his Lotus 72's
Besides all the many technical differences pointed out, the graphics on the JPS livery changed quite a bit from iridescent gold in '72/'73 to a solid yellow as did some contingency decals on the front wings for '74-'75. The 1/20 MFH kits of the Lotus 72E and 76 capture this quite well.
